Le Clarence de Haut-Brion 2016 Pessac-Leognan, Bordeaux, France

Le Clarence de Haut-Brion 2016 Pessac-Leognan, Bordeaux, France

The name of the second label produced by Château Haut-Brion, unique in being the only Premier Cru Classé in the Pessac-Léognan appellation. Previously known Château Bahans Haut-Brion but was renamed in 2007 to honour the memory of Clarence Dillon.
